Employer Manchester University NHS Foundation Trust Employer type NHS Site Wythenshawe Hospital Town Manchester Salary £31,049 - £37,796 Per Annum (Pro Rata) Salary period Yearly Closing 15/12/2025 23:59NHS AfC: Band 5Job overviewWe are recruiting Band 5 staff nurses to work within our highly skilled, dynamic multi-disciplinary team. This is an excellent opportunity for you to join our Adult Intensive Care, which accommodates both level 3 and level 2 patients. We provide care for patients from many specialties which more recently includes both Thoracic and Burns patients.We are seeking to recruit energetic, enthusiastic and experienced nurses to provide high standards of care to patients. The successful candidate will be welcomed into our friendly, forward thinking and motivated team .Main duties of the jobWe are looking to recruit hardworking individuals to work as part of a large team within our busy Intensive Care Unit. Previous experience in an acute setting is essential, with experience in burns or thoracics being highly desirable . ICU experience is desirable but not essential as comprehensive in-service training is provided.We offer a supportive environment and good work-life balance with a rostering system that is responsive to the needs of staff.
